Produced in cooperation with the National Association of School Nurses, this text includes comprehensive coverage of the multiple facets of school nursing--from the foundations of practice and the roles and functions of a school nurse through episodic and chronic illness and behavioral issues, to legal issues and leading and managing within school settings.
